[slim] SB3 Loops in reset
My SP3 has given me sterling service since I bought it a few years ago, but it seems to have developed a fault that I hope is not terminal. I had it hooked up to wi-fi, working fine for months and months. Then, a few weeks back, it would just stop in the middle of a song and then carry on. It got worse and it started resetting at random times. I dropped back to a wired connection - no difference in behaviour. I swapped it out for another SB3 and that worked impeccably on the same PSU and Cat5. Put the original SB3 on the PSU of the other working SB3 and now it just cycles through the SqueezeBox banner, then blank, then banner again ad infinitum. I've tried resetting to factory defaults by holding down the ADD key whilst applying power, but all I see is the banner message struggling to scroll across the screen. Any ideas about where to go from here would be great. 1. Fix it. 2. Bin it, buy new equivalent from Amazon £185 :-( 3. Find someone who can fix it, economically. 4. ? Re: [slim] SB3 Loops in reset
If you are not afraid to do a little electronic surgery you can try opening the SB3 and removing the WiFi card. Removing it has helped solve such oddball behavior in the past. If the WiFi card is dead or even flaky it can cause general connection issues even when using ethernet. Re: [slim] SB3 Loops in reset
Well, it was worth a try. :) Couple of other last ditch ideas: - did you actually go through the Setup screen to choose wired? Simply plugging in an ethernet cable does not make it wired. Assuming it will even allow you into the Setup screen (press hold left arrow). - try a Xilinx reset, though this is really just for audio issues and settings I believe.
